174 students earned Other Allied Health Diagnostic, Intervention, and Treatment Professions degrees in Utah in the 2022-2023 year.

In this state, Other Allied Health Diagnostic, Intervention, and Treatment Professions is the 210th most popular major out of a total 622 majors commonly available.
